Template rendering in Quillbarn is the main latency driver on the dashboard path. We precompile templates at boot and cache them keyed by locale; cache misses cost roughly 40ms each. The cache is backed by Fernhollow's shared store, which requires authentication. Before running the service locally, set the store's access secret in your env file on the next line.

vault entry, yahif-yajep: COURIER_KEY29=b802bdf8034096b65a51c6ba5abe2

14:22 — The Sproutly scheduler stopped dispatching watering jobs for greenhouse zones 3 through 7. On-call engineer Marta Vellin confirmed the cron shard had drifted after the weekend clock adjustment. Jobs queued but never fired, so several customers reported dry planters by mid-afternoon. A manual flush of the queue restored normal dispatch at 15:10. Support should reference this window when triaging tickets from that day. The exact build that contained the drift fix is noted below.

build token for kagaf-hahof: htk14_9d3d4d26d7d8de

### Account Recovery — Catalogue Import (Lintwood)

Quick one for review: when the Lintwood catalogue import wipes a patron's session table, the recovery flow re-seeds accounts from the nightly snapshot. Check that the importer skips locked accounts — last time it didn't. To rerun recovery against staging you'll need the vault passphrase, which is appended just below.

recovery phrase for yafof-tajof: julmir-kelax-julvan-holath-belvan-holir-ralael-ralvan-ralath-julvan-silmir-istmir-kaswyn-ulamir